  • Ruben Lenten demonstrating big air has no limits after jumping a total lenght of 94 meters next to a tugboat in Cape Town

    Novembre 17, 2022 / Kitesurf

    Ruben Lenten:

    On a particular afternoon whilst on holiday in Bonaire I got a phone call from a production house with the question, how big do you guys actually jump with Big Air kiteboarding?

    They had a cool project in mind to better showcase what speeds, heights and distances are involved when performing our tricks. We quickly assembled a team consisting of Janek, Lasse, and myself to take on the challenge. 

    In order to put things into perspective we found the right vessels to race and jump. It showed that we as kiters are quite maneuverable and can accelerate very quickly and fast. On the rib we didn’t stand a chance of keeping up with Lasse on the open ocean. 

    Once we got on the water and kited far out towards the tugboat, the ship just kept getting bigger and bigger. With a total length of 94 meters, we were able to cover the full length. The wind wasn’t super strong and I was riding my 10m Edge V11 for this challenge but we had quite some power and plenty of fun. 

    Jumping over things always adds a layer of risk and adrenaline. It’s very scary, especially when it’s in the open ocean and the water is really rough. It was super challenging to pick a takeoff spot but you just had to commit and send it for the best. I was stoked to get a nice megaloop right over the boat.

    After jumping the length and height of the tugboat we got an invite to kite closer to the huge container ships. That was even more impressive to kite next to such a large ship, wow. There was no way we would reach the height of this ship and its containers but we definitely had fun flying next to it. Some epic shots!

    Check out the full video here: https://win.gs/ShipJump

    This video hopefully gives the general public a better idea of what we’re doing out there, and what speed, height, and distance goes into some of the tricks at the Red Bull King of the Air. The event is coming up again soon, and the world’s best riders are here in Cape Town already and hungry for a win.
